Hi Per It's probably as easy to filter and binarise the input yourself before tuning using the filter-model-given-input.pl script in Moses, and using the -Binarizer argument to pass it the path to the processPhraseTable binary.
By default, mert-moses.pl will filter (so the command below will filter) and this may reduce the size of the phrase table sufficiently for you. You can add binarisation to mert-moses.pl by using the --filtercmd to give it the filter script with its binariser argument, cheers - Barry On 11/03/13 15:27, Per Tunedal wrote: > Hi, > thanks for your kind advice.
